US seizes Venezuelan-linked tanker in Indian Ocean

ALBAWABA- US military forces have boarded the Panama-flagged Suezmax oil tanker Aquila II in the Indian Ocean after a transoceanic pursuit from the Caribbean, part of an intensifying campaign to enforce sanctions on Venezuelan oil and disrupt the so-called “shadow fleet” of sanctioned tankers.
